Inkerman Grove is in Wolverhampton and in Wolverhampton district. WV10 0EU is located in the Heath Town elect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Wolverhampton North East.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ding WV10 0EU is primarily male, with 53.5%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Female | 43.8% | 46.5% | 2.7% | 51.0% | -4.5% |
| Male | 56.2% | 53.5% | -2.7% | 49.0% | 4.5%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Inkerman Grove was 94.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 2.6% higher than the Fallings Park average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Inkerman Grove has the 25th highest crime rate of 56 local areas in Fallings Park and the 283rd highest crime rate of 784 local areas in Wolverhampton .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 75.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 7.6%.
